What people love
Coatepec Harinas, located in the State of Mexico, Mexico, offers several advantages for travelers looking to explore this region:
-
Natural Beauty: Coatepec Harinas is known for its stunning natural landscapes, including mountains, forests, and rivers.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y activities such as hiking, bird watching, and photography in this picturesque setting.
-
Cultural Heritage: The town of Coatepec Harinas has a rich cultural heritage, with historic architecture, traditional festivals, and local crafts. Visitors can explore the town's colonial-era buildings, visit local artisans, and experience authentic Mexican cuisine.
-
Tranquility: Coatepec Harinas is a peaceful destination away from the hustle and bustle of larger cities. Travelers seeking a quiet retreat will appreciate the tranquility and slower pace of life in this charming town.
-
Outdoor Recreation: The surrounding area offers opportunities for various outdoor activities, such as horseback riding, camping, and fishing. The nearby Sierra de Tenango National Park provides a scenic backdrop for adventures in nature.
-
Local Hospitality: Visitors to Coatepec Harinas can expect warm hospitality from the local residents, who are known for their friendliness and welcoming attitude towards tourists. Travelers can immerse themselves in the local culture and experience authentic Mexican hospitality.
Overall, Coatepec Harinas is a destination that offers a combination of natural beauty, cultural richness, and tranquility, making it an appealing choice for travelers seeking a unique and authentic Mexican experience.
What to know
Coatepec Harinas is a small town located in the State of Mexico, Mexico. While it is a beautiful and culturally rich destination, there are some cons to consider when traveling there:
-
Limited tourist infrastructure: Coatepec Harinas is not a major tourist destination, so it may lack the tourist infrastructure found in more popular locations. This could mean limited accommodation options, restaurants, and tour guides.
-
Transportation challenges: Getting to Coatepec Harinas may involve multiple modes of transportation, as it is not easily accessible by major highways or airports. This could make travel to and from the town time-consuming and potentially complicated.
-
Language barrier: While some locals may speak English or other languages, the primary language spoken in Coatepec Harinas is Spanish. If you do not speak Spanish, communication may be a challenge, especially when trying to navigate the town or interact with locals.
-
Limited activities: Coatepec Harinas is a small town, so there may be limited activities and attractions to keep you entertained for an extended period. If you are looking for a bustling nightlife or a wide variety of shopping options, you may find Coatepec Harinas lacking in these areas.
-
Safety concerns: While Coatepec Harinas is generally considered safe for tourists, it is always important to exercise caution and be aware of your surroundings. Like any destination, there may be petty crimes or scams targeting tourists, so it is essential to take necessary precautions.
Overall, while Coatepec Harinas is a charming destination worth exploring, it is essential to consider these potential cons before planning your trip.
